Getting There

  • Walking

    If you are staying in the central area of Paphos, start at the Paphos Harbor. Head southwest along the waterfront promenade, enjoying the views of the sea. Continue walking until you reach the end of the promenade, where you will see the entrance to the Archaeological Site of Nea Paphos on your right. The site is a short distance from the harbor, approximately 15 minutes on foot.

  • Public Bus

    From the central bus station in Paphos, take bus number 615 towards Coral Bay. Make sure to ask the driver to let you know when you reach the stop for the Archaeological Site of Nea Paphos. The journey takes about 10 minutes, and the bus stop is located just a short walk from the site entrance.

  • Bicycle Rental

    If you prefer to bike, you can rent a bicycle from one of the many rental shops near the Paphos Harbor. From there, cycle along the coastal road heading west. Follow the signs for the Archaeological Site of Nea Paphos. It is about a 10-minute ride and offers beautiful views of the coastline along the way.

Discover more about Archaeological Site of Nea Paphos

Nea Paphos, located in the picturesque coastal city of Paphos in Cyprus, is a remarkable archaeological site that transports visitors back to the depths of history. Designated as a UNESCO World Heritage Site, this ancient city was once the capital of Cyprus during the Roman period and is renowned for its exquisite mosaics, which depict mythological scenes and showcase the artistry of the time. The well-preserved ruins, including the grand amphitheater and the remnants of opulent villas, tell a story of a once-thriving urban center that flourished with commerce and culture. As you stroll through the sprawling site, you'll encounter the iconic House of Dionysus, where intricate mosaic floors celebrate the god of wine through vibrant and detailed artistry. The site is not only a feast for history enthusiasts but also a haven for photographers, offering stunning views of the Mediterranean coastline and captivating sunsets. Take your time to explore the ancient streets, which are lined with remnants of temples, baths, and intricate frescoes that breathe life into the stories of those who walked these paths centuries ago.
